Effect of regulated deficit irrigation and partial root zone drying on yield and quality characteristics of mango cv. Banganpalli

ABSTRACT
This experiment was carried out during 2013-14 and 2014-15 seasons on Banganpalli mango trees at Amarachintha village as adoptive on farm trail of CRIDA. The irrigation water requirement is determined by using average season wise pan evaporation data for that area. Different irrigation treatments viz.,T1 – No irrigation; T2 - RDI at 100 % Ep; T3 - RDI at 75 % Ep; T4 - RDI at 50 % Ep;T5 – PRD at 50 % Ep; T6 – PRD at 75 % Ep. among all treatments, The maximum fruit number (139.5 and 129.0), yield per plant (52.9kg and 50.0kg), fruit weight (379.0g and 360.0g), pulp weight (288.27g and 274.0g), per cent pulp (79.38%), pulp to seed ratio (6.74 and 6.85) and least per centage of stone (11.80% and 11.45%) were observed in I2 (RDI at 100 % Ep) during both the seasons. The maximum total soluble solids (18.5 0Brix and 19.0 0Brix) and less acidity (0.38% and 0.36%) was noticed with I4 (RDI 50 % Ep).
